Highlights
Are people in Big Lake older or younger than people in Bay View?
- The Median Age in Big Lake is 5.4 years younger than in Bay View.
Are housing costs cheaper in Big Lake or Bay View?
- Big Lake
housing
costs are 20.5% less expensive than Bay View housing costs.
Which city has a longer commute, Big Lake or Bay View?
- The average commute for residents of Big Lake is 7.4 minutes longer than it is for residents of Bay View.

Things to do in Big Lake?
Big Lake, WA is a charming small town located in the Cascade Mountains of Washington State. The town is known for its deep blue lake and stunning mountain views. Residents of Big Lake enjoy tranquility, nature and outdoor recreation activities like hiking, fishing, kayaking and camping in the nearby National Forest. In addition to the outdoor activities offered by the surrounding area, Big Lake offers a variety of unique restaurants, shops and events that bring life to this idyllic community. Life in Big Lake is centered around its picturesque landscape, making it a place where people can enjoy peace and relaxation while still being close to modern amenities.
